Sunday, May 12, 2024

Tag: Glen Mallan

University students are all at sea with HMS Queen Elizabeth

LAST week the Nation’s flagship, HMS Queen Elizabeth arrived at Glen Mallan for the third time since her launch in 2014. Making the journey from...

Latest News